Role of IGFBP6 Protein in the Regulation of Epithelial-Mesenchymal Transition Genes.

Bulletin of experimental biology and medicine (2018-03-27)
S V Nikulin, M P Raigorodskaya, A A Poloznikov, G S Zakharova, U Schumacher, D Wicklein, C Stürken, K Riecken, K A Fomicheva, B Ya Alekseev, M Yu Shkurnikov
RÉSUMÉ

Protein IGFBP6 plays an important role in the pathogenesis of many malignant tumors, including breast cancer. The relationship between IGFBP6 protein and the expression of genes associated with the epithelial-mesenchymal transition is studied. Gene IGFBP6 knockdown does not trigger the epithelial-mesenchymal transition in MDA-MB-231 cells, but modifies significantly the expression of many genes involved in this process. A decrease of IGFBP6 expression can involve a decrease in the expression of N-cadherin and transcription factor Slug.
